Job Description

Job Description:
Responsible for the daily activities related to the installation of contract furniture systems. Duties may also include delivery, assembly, installation, repair and service of warranty and non-warranty office furniture case-goods and seating.
Primary Responsibilities:
Ability to read construction and CAD installation blueprints, and Install contract systems furniture Capable of field measuring a worksite in preparation for installation Complete furniture assembly/installation as per installation specifications and drawings Assess and document service related issues Repair and service systems furniture, casegoods and seating Follow all safety procedures as designated by Project Manager or site Ability to unload incoming furniture trucks using material handling equipment (i.e., forklift, pallet jack)
Requirements:
High school diploma or general education degree (GED) required Must be able to lift, push or pull product weighing between 50 pounds and 100 pounds Minimum of two (2) years experience as a contract furniture installer Must have a valid driver's license Experience driving lightweight trucks preferred Experience in using hand and electrical tools to assemble furniture Ability to read and speak the English language sufficient to converse with the general public Ability to respond to official inquiries, and to make written entries on reports and records Excellent customer service skills, conducting customer contact in a professional and courteous manner
Job Type:
Full-time Pay:
$18.00 - $28.00 per hour
